Course Description

The Federal workplace is rapidly changing. As Baby Boomers retire, Generation Z employees are entering the workplace. And in between, you have Gen X and Millennials. How do you not only work with, but lead such a diverse array of generations? This two-hour class will show you how to use generational differences to understand your workforce – not categorize it. You will leave with foundational tools for motivating and mentoring your multi-generational team.

Attendees will learn also how to:

  • Understand key events that have impacted each generation
  • Identify potential workplace sticking points where generations may have different preferences, such as feedback or meetings, and use them as opportunities for new solutions
  • Develop strategies for communicating with different generations
